Samuel E. (Ted) Knighton

Chief Operating Officer
Interstate Hotels & Resorts

Ted Knighton is chief operating officer for Interstate Hotels & Resorts, responsible for overseeing and integrating operations of the company’s nearly 400 hotels worldwide which currently spans 10 countries. Through November 2011 he served as Interstate’s president of hotel operations, a position he held since 2006, responsible for Interstate’s North American portfolio, the company’s largest region.

A 21-year veteran of Interstate, Knighton was previously executive vice president, operations-full service hotel division. Prior to that he was executive vice president of the company’s investment fund/joint venture portfolio. Earlier, he served as executive vice president of operations for Interstate’s Crossroads division, encompassing hotels in the select-service, extended-stay, and mid-market segments.

Prior to joining Interstate Hotels Corp., a predecessor company, in 1990, Knighton was vice president of operations for Radisson Hotels. He also has worked for Hyatt Hotels Corporation.

Knighton holds a bachelor’s degree in hotel administration from Cornell University.
